The problem is that scan_fast() allocate memory for ubi-&gt;fm
and ubi-&gt;fm-&gt;e[x], but if the following attach process fails
in ubi_wl_init or ubi_read_volume_table, the whole attach
process will fail without executing ubi_wl_close to free the
memory under ubi-&gt;fm.

Fix this by add a new ubi_free_fastmap function in fastmap.c
to free the memory allocated for fm.

This patch prevents unnecessary programming of bits in ec_hdr and
vid_hdr that are not used or read during normal UBI operation. These
unused bits are typcially already set to 1 in erased flash and do not
need to be explicitly programmed to 0 if they are not used.

Programming such unused areas offers no functional benefit and may
result in unnecessary flash wear, reducing the overall lifetime of the
device. By skipping these writes, we preserve the flash state as much as
possible and minimize wear caused by redundant operations.

This change ensures that only necessary fields are written when preparing
UBI headers, improving flash efficiency without affecting functionality.

Additionally, the Kioxia TC58NVG1S3HTA00 datasheet (page 63) also notes
that continuous program/erase cycling with a high percentage of '0' bits
in the data pattern can accelerate block endurance degradation.
This further supports avoiding large 0x00 patterns.

Currently, "max_ec" can be read from sysfs, which provides a limited
view of the flash device’s wear. In certain cases, such as bugs in
the wear-leveling algorithm, specific blocks can be worn down more
than others, resulting in uneven wear distribution. Also some use cases
can wear the erase blocks of the fastmap area more heavily than other
parts of flash.
Providing detailed erase counter values give a better understanding of
the overall flash wear and is needed to be able to calculate for example
expected life time.
There exists more detailed info in debugfs, but this information is
only available for debug builds.

Commit 5580cdae05ae ("ubi: wl: Close down wear-leveling before nand is
suspended") added a reboot notification in UBI layer to shutdown the
wear-leveling subsystem, which imported an UAF problem[1]. Besides that,
the method also brings other potential UAF problems, for example:
       reboot             kworker
 ubi_wl_reboot_notifier
  ubi_wl_close
   ubi_fastmap_close
    kfree(ubi-&gt;fm)
                     update_fastmap_work_fn
		      ubi_update_fastmap
		       old_fm = ubi-&gt;fm
		       if (old_fm &amp;&amp; old_fm-&gt;e[i]) // UAF!

Actually, the problem fixed by commit 5580cdae05ae ("ubi: wl: Close down
wear-leveling before nand is suspended") has been solved by commit
8cba323437a4 ("mtd: rawnand: protect access to rawnand devices while in
suspend"), which was discussed in [2]. So we can revert the commit
5580cdae05ae ("ubi: wl: Close down wear-leveling before nand is
suspended") directly.
